1. 在GDB中引用Shell:
shell ls
2. 设置输入参数:
set args inputfile 10
3. 断点:
b main.c:12
b getargs
b 3353 (current context)
info b
del 1
enable 1
disable 3
4. 观察点:
watch var==value (static or global)
watch *((int *)(0x888888) (address in memory)
5. 查看数据:
x /16b pBuf (examine memory in Bytes)
print sParam (查看变量)
6. 远程调试:
1) <target> ./gdbserver :1111 test
2) <host> arm-linux-gdb test
3) <host> target remote x.x.x.x:1111
4) <host> b main
5) <host> c
...
GDB备忘录
最新推荐文章于 2025-05-01 19:20:50 发布